    My husband and I were looking for a good brunch spot.. we came across Carolyn's on Yelp.. after seeing all the great reviews it had.. we had to give it a try. Upon ariving, we learnt that there was a 30 min wait for a table for 2 on a Monday morning. Don't let the wait discourage you. Trust me, it's worth the wait. The food here is AMAZING! The portions are nice and big, definitely shareable, but you're going to want to order plenty. I got the Mediterranean omelet.. this dish was so flavorful, the garlic stands out. My husband order the cinnamon roll pancakes.. I don't even like pancakes.. but I couldn't get enough of these fluffy, yet crispy and so so flavorful pancakes. We also ordered a side of onion rings. Which were so delicious, crispy and tender in the inside! Now last, but not least the coffee cake.. you have to try these.. they are the star of the show. So delicious. They are topped off with butter which just melts into the cake.. perfect for dessert or even to have with your coffee. Food was impeccable, but so was the customer service. Everyone there was kind, accommodating and friendly. Our lovely waitress was Claudia.. she was the sweetest.. she gave us great recommendations, made sure we were well taken cared of.. and was just amazing! The ambience reminds me of an old school diner.. so special and homey!

    This is a very popular breakfast place and rightfully so. The food was good and the service was friendly! We thought we might miss the crowd by going 10:30am on a Monday but nope, It's definitely busy all the time. The *California Eggs Benedict was delicious! I loved the green salsa instead of the hollandaise. I got it with the coffee cake and the fruit. Just like everyone says the coffee cake is really good. It's moist and very sweet. It was way too much butter for my taste. It really doesn't need it. The fruit fresh and sweet. Yumm!! My mom got the *Little Combo with scrambled eggs, bacon and biscuits with gravy. It was a lot of food for a little combo and she said it was all very tasty. I liked the gravy I tasted. All this with coffee & tip was $44. I recommend this spot for a good breakfast if you're in the area!

    Do you guys have any gift certificates/gift cards?

    Yes. Purchase in person or call the cafe between 7am-1pm. 909-335-8181 x4. We will be closed on Christmas Day and also closed on 12/26/25.

    What is the size of the special order coffee cake for Thanksgiving?

    9x13 pan - feeds up to 12 people and includes whipped butter.

    Is there a way to order food cooked without using seed oils? Thank you for answering .?

    Yes, we can offer limited menu options cooked in butter instead of seed oils - you just need to be sure to clarify with the person taking your order.

    Hello! Is this lovely establishment open on Labor Day?

    Yes - open regular hours - 7am-1pm

    Will you be open thanksgiving morning?

    Carolyns Cafe will be closed on Thanksgiving Day.

    Family member has nut allergy. Does your coffee cake contain nuts?

    Although the coffee cake itself does not contain any nuts, 2 of the ingredients come from a supplier that processes nuts at the same facility. So, even though we would love your whole family to enjoy our delicious coffee cake, it might be best for…

    Are you guys planning to expand your hours soon? 1pm is too soon ...

    We are not planning on expanding our hours anytime soon. Minimum wage is now $14.00 per hour and will be increasing again next year. It makes it too expensive for us to stay open longer.
